Social Media Marketing for Website Promotion in Digital Marketing

In the digital age, having a website is essential — but having a great website isn’t enough. People need to find it. That’s where social media marketing (SMM) comes in. As a key component of digital marketing, social media acts as a powerful channel to drive traffic, engagement, and conversions on your website.

🔹 What Is Social Media Marketing?

Social media marketing involves creating and sharing content on social media platforms (like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, Twitter/X, TikTok, and Pinterest) to achieve marketing goals such as increasing website traffic, building brand awareness, and boosting sales.


💡 How Social Media Supports Website Growth

1. Driving Traffic to Your Website

  • Sharing blog posts, product pages, or landing pages directly encourages clicks.
  • CTAs like “Read More,” “Shop Now,” or “Visit Our Website” guide users to take action.
  • Use tools like link in bio or swipe-up links on Instagram Stories to funnel traffic.

2. Building Brand Visibility

  • Regular, engaging content builds a brand presence and makes your website more recognizable.
  • When users trust your brand on social, they’re more likely to explore your website.

3. Improving SEO (Indirectly)

  • While social media doesn’t directly impact SEO rankings, it increases content visibility.
  • More shares = more potential backlinks = better search engine performance.

4. Generating Leads and Conversions

  • Social media ad campaigns can direct users to lead capture pages or eCommerce pages.
  • Retargeting campaigns remind users to return to your website if they didn’t convert the first time.

🔧 Best Practices for Promoting a Website on Social Media

  • Optimize Your Profiles: Include your website link in bios and ensure branding is consistent across platforms.
  • Use High-Quality Visuals: Eye-catching images and videos increase engagement.
  • Post Consistently: Develop a content calendar to keep your audience engaged.
  • Use Paid Ads Strategically: Promote key pages, products, or blog posts using paid social advertising.
  • Leverage Stories and Reels: Use short-form content to tease website content or products.
  • Engage With Followers: Answer questions, comment back, and build relationships.
  • Track Performance: Use UTM codes and tools like Google Analytics to track how much traffic and conversions come from social media.
